Here is my proposed patch for this bug:
diff --git a/Zend/zend_stream.c b/Zend/zend_stream.c
index 3fd7fa0..f5b9bea 100644
--- a/Zend/zend_stream.c
+++ b/Zend/zend_stream.c
@@ -30,7 +30,11 @@
# if HAVE_UNISTD_H
# include <unistd.h>
# if defined(_SC_PAGESIZE)
+# ifdef __CYGWIN__
+#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E 4096
+# else
#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E sysconf(_SC_PAGESIZE);
+# endif
# elif defined(_SC_PAGE_SIZE)
#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E sysconf(_SC_PAGE_SIZE);
# endif
diff --git a/main/main.c b/main/main.c
index 01ed3a6..0909309 100644
--- a/main/main.c
+++ b/main/main.c
@@ -96,7 +96,11 @@
# if HAVE_UNISTD_H
# include <unistd.h>
# if defined(_SC_PAGESIZE)
+# ifdef __CYGWIN__
+#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E 4096
+# else
#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E sysconf(_SC_PAGESIZE);
+# endif
# elif defined(_SC_PAGE_SIZE)
# define REAL_PAGE_SIZE sysconf(_SC_PAGE_SIZE);
# endif
This definition needs to be fixed in two places as there are two
different places where a PHP source file can be mmap()ed, depending on
whether it is loaded using php-cli or loaded when php is run from a library.
On 02/05/2017 11:28, Richard H Lee wrote:
Should this fix go upstream to PHP or be submitted to the PHP
package within Cygwin?
I ask this as partially accessibly memory pages I guess are a quirk of
Cygwin. But then again programs ideally should not read past the end of
the EOF in the region the file is mmap()ed to.
